About this book
This graphic novel adaptation of the bestselling I Survived series drops readers onto the RMS Titanic with George and his little sister as they explore the grand ship on its fateful voyage. Fast, cinematic panels and clear text make the history accessible for elementary and middle grade readers. Kids love the nonstop tension, brave problem-solving, and kid-centered point of view, all while picking up real facts about the disaster. It’s an exciting, approachable way to experience history through action and heart.
Setting: aboard the RMS Titanic in the North Atlantic, 1912

What grade level is I Survived the Sinking of the Titanic, 1912: A Graphic Novel (I Survived Graphic Novel #1)?
I Survived the Sinking of the Titanic, 1912: A Graphic Novel (I Survived Graphic Novel #1) has an AR reading level of 2.9, which places it at a 2nd grade reading difficulty. The interest level is rated Middle Grades (4–8) — this reflects the age-appropriateness of the content and themes, not just the reading difficulty. A strong younger reader may handle the words fine while the themes are aimed at an older audience, or vice versa.
